Tower of God, made because of the South Korean artist SIU (Lee Jong-hui), initially emerged being a webtoon in 2010 around the platform Naver Webtoon. To begin with, it absolutely was a modest job, but it surely promptly acquired traction as a consequence of its compelling narrative and intricate globe-constructing. The Tale follows a younger boy named Bam, who enters a mysterious tower in quest of his Good friend Rachel. 

Just about every flooring on the tower offers exceptional troubles and characters, creating a loaded tapestry of journey and intrigue. The webtoon’s one of a kind artwork style, combined with its engaging plot, resonated with viewers, resulting in a gradual boost in its fanbase. As being the series progressed, its acceptance soared further than South Korea, capturing the eye of Global audiences.

By 2020, Tower of God had amassed countless audience worldwide, rendering it The most-study webtoons on the Naver platform. The collection' achievement might be attributed to its common themes of friendship, ambition, as well as the battle for identification, which resonate with a various viewers. This Worldwide attraction laid the groundwork for further more adaptations and items, solidifying Tower of God’s position as a global phenomenon.

The Evolution of Tower of God: From Webtoon to Anime Adaptation


In 2020, Tower of God built a substantial leap from webtoon to anime adaptation, made by Telecom Animation Film and aired on Crunchyroll. This changeover marked a pivotal moment for that series, introducing it to an excellent broader viewers who may well not are already accustomed to webtoons. The anime adaptation retained much of the first story's essence whilst maximizing it with dynamic animation and a fascinating soundtrack.

This visual illustration introduced the figures as well as their struggles to existence in a brand new way, even further engaging lovers each outdated and new. The anime adaptation also sparked renewed interest in the initial webtoon, bringing about an influx of latest viewers eager to check out the resource material. The synergy amongst the webtoon and its anime counterpart exemplifies how adaptations can greatly enhance a franchise's get to though sustaining its core narrative things.

Furthermore, the accomplishment with the anime has opened doorways for possible foreseeable future adaptations of other preferred webtoons, signaling a change in how animated material is generated and eaten globally.
